前端可视化大屏的制作可以通过以下几种方式实现:选择合适的图表类型、使用响应式设计、优化数据加载。其中,选择合适的图表类型尤为重要,不同的图表适合展示不同类型的数据。例如,柱状图适用于比较数据的大小,折线图则适合展示数据的趋势。合理的图表选择能帮助用户更快、更清晰地理解数据内容。通过针对观众需求的精确选择,可以有效提升可视化大屏的使用价值和用户体验。
一、选择合适的图表类型
在制作前端可视化大屏时,选择合适的图表类型是关键的一步。不同的数据特点和展示需求会影响图表的选择。柱状图、折线图、饼图等基本图表各有优缺点:
- 柱状图适合展示不同类别的数量比较,特别是在需要强调各项数据之间差异时。
- 折线图常用于展示时间序列数据的变化趋势,帮助用户理解数据随时间的波动。
- 饼图则适合展示数据的比例关系,如市场份额或人口构成等。
选择正确的图表类型可以使数据展示更直观,提升信息传递的效率。在选择图表时,还需考虑图表的复杂度和用户的理解能力,避免因图表类型不当而引发误解。
二、使用响应式设计
响应式设计对于前端可视化大屏至关重要,因为它可以确保大屏在不同设备上都有良好的展示效果。响应式设计主要包括以下几点:
- 调整图表大小和布局:根据设备屏幕的大小和分辨率调整图表的尺寸和布局,以保证数据的可读性。
- 优化用户交互体验:例如,在移动设备上使用触摸手势放大缩小图表,增强用户的操作体验。
- 保证性能稳定性:使用响应式设计时,还需关注数据加载速度和页面响应速度,以提供流畅的用户体验。
三、优化数据加载
优化数据加载是确保前端可视化大屏高效运作的关键。以下是一些优化策略:
- 使用异步数据加载:通过异步请求,减少页面加载时间,提升用户体验。
- 数据缓存:对于不经常变化的数据,可以使用缓存机制,避免每次访问都重新加载数据。
- 数据压缩与传输优化:使用数据压缩技术和传输协议优化,减少数据传输的带宽占用,提高加载速度。
四、注重数据安全性
在前端可视化大屏的设计中,数据安全性同样不容忽视。大屏展示的数据可能包含敏感信息,因此需要采取措施保障数据的安全性:
- 数据加密:在数据传输和存储过程中使用加密技术,防止数据泄露。
- 权限控制:设置合理的权限管理机制,确保只有授权用户才能访问特定的数据。
- 日志审计:对数据访问和操作进行日志记录,以便后续追踪和审计。
五、提供可交互的用户界面
提供可交互的用户界面能极大提高用户体验,让用户更深入地探索数据。实现可交互的用户界面可以通过以下方式:
- 工具提示和信息框:在用户悬停或点击图表元素时,显示详细的数据说明或提示。
- 数据筛选和过滤功能:允许用户通过选择条件筛选数据,以关注特定的数据集。
- 动态更新和动画效果:使用动画效果动态展示数据变化,提高可视化的生动性和吸引力。
总之,前端可视化大屏的制作需要综合考虑数据展示、用户体验和技术实现等多个方面。合理的图表选择、响应式设计、数据加载优化以及数据安全措施都是成功的关键。为了更好地实现这些目标,FineReport和FineVis等工具可以提供专业的支持和解决方案。
如需了解更多信息,欢迎访问FineReport和FineVis的官方网站:
- FineReport官网: https://s.fanruan.com/ryhzq;
- FineVis官网: https://s.fanruan.com/7z296;
相关问答FAQs:
前端可视化大屏是什么?
前端可视化大屏通常是指通过前端技术展示数据的可视化界面。它能够将复杂的数据以直观的方式呈现出来,帮助用户快速理解和分析信息。大屏展示广泛应用于商业分析、监控系统、城市管理、交通监控等领域。通过各种图表、仪表盘、地图等形式,用户可以实时查看数据的变化和趋势,进行数据驱动的决策。
前端可视化大屏的主要技术有哪些?
构建前端可视化大屏通常需要多种技术的结合。首先,HTML、CSS和JavaScript是基础的前端开发语言,用于构建页面结构和样式。其次,数据可视化库如D3.js、Chart.js、ECharts等,可以帮助开发者将数据转化为图形化的展示形式。使用这些库,开发者可以创建条形图、折线图、饼图等多种图表,以便更好地展示数据。此外,前端框架如React、Vue或Angular,可以帮助开发者构建更加高效和维护性好的应用,尤其是在处理复杂的数据交互时。最后,WebSocket和RESTful API等技术也常用于实现实时数据更新,使得大屏展示更加动态和互动。
如何设计一个高效的前端可视化大屏?
设计一个高效的前端可视化大屏需要考虑多个方面。首先,界面的布局和风格要简洁明了,避免信息过载。选择合适的颜色和字体,确保信息的可读性。其次,应根据数据的特性选择合适的可视化方式。例如,对于时间序列数据,折线图可能更为合适;而对于分类数据,柱状图或饼图则可能更容易理解。交互性也是设计中的重要因素,用户应能够通过筛选、缩放等操作来深入分析数据。此外,性能优化也不可忽视,特别是在处理大量数据时,合理使用缓存和懒加载等技术,能够显著提升用户体验。最后,在设计的过程中,务必进行用户测试,以收集反馈并不断改进大屏的展示效果和用户体验。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。